데이터베이스 소프트웨어의 역할은 무엇인가요?
_____A1: 데이터베이스 소프트웨어는 데이터를 저장, 관리, 검색, 수정 및 삭제할 수 있도록 도와주는 프로그램입니다. 사용자가 데이터를 효율적으로 다룰 수 있게 해주는 시스템입니다.
Q2: 데이터베이스 소프트웨어의 주요 역할은 무엇인가요?
A2: 주요 역할은 다음과 같습니다.
- 데이터 저장: 대량의 데이터를 안전하게 저장합니다.
- 데이터 관리: 데이터의 무결성(정확성)과 보안을 유지합니다.
- 데이터 검색: 사용자가 원하는 데이터를 빠르고 효율적으로 검색할 수 있도록 합니다.
- 동시 접근 지원: 여러 사용자가 동시에 데이터를 안전하게 접근하고 수정할 수 있도록 지원합니다.
Q3: 데이터베이스 소프트웨어가 왜 중요한가요?
A3: 데이터베이스 소프트웨어는 대량의 데이터를 체계적으로 관리하여 비즈니스 운영의 효율성을 높이고, 데이터 오류를 최소화하며, 보안과 접근성을 동시에 보장하기 때문에 현대 IT 환경에서 필수적입니다.
Q4: 데이터베이스 소프트웨어는 어떤 종류가 있나요?
A4: 대표적인 종류로는 관계형 데이터베이스 관리 시스템(RDBMS), NoSQL 데이터베이스, 그래프 데이터베이스 등이 있으며, 각각 저장 방식과 용도가 다릅니다.
Q5: 데이터베이스 소프트웨어는 비즈니스에 어떤 도움을 주나요?
A5: 데이터베이스 소프트웨어는 고객 정보 관리, 재고 관리, 매출 데이터 분석 등 다양한 비즈니스 데이터를 체계적으로 관리함으로써 신속한 의사결정과 업무 자동화를 도와줍니다.
데이터베이스 소프트웨어의 역할은 여러 가지로 나눌 수 있으며, 그 중 주요한 역할은 다음과 같습니다.
1. 데이터 저장 및 관리 데이터베이스 소프트웨어는 대량의 데이터를 구조화된 형태로 저장할 수 있도록 설계되어 있습니다.
이를 통해 사용자는 데이터를 쉽게 관리하고, 필요할 때 신속하게 접근할 수 있습니다.
데이터는 일반적으로 테이블 형태로 저장되며, 각 테이블은 특정한 데이터 유형을 나타냅니다.
예를 들어, 고객 정보, 제품 정보, 주문 내역 등을 각각의 테이블로 관리할 수 있습니다.
2. 데이터 무결성 유지 데이터베이스 소프트웨어는 데이터의 무결성을 보장하는 다양한 기능을 제공합니다.
무결성이란 데이터가 정확하고 일관되며 신뢰할 수 있는 상태를 의미합니다.
이를 위해 데이터베이스는 제약 조건(예: 기본 키, 외래 키, 유일성 제약 등)을 설정하여 데이터의 유효성을 검사하고, 잘못된 데이터 입력을 방지합니다.
3. 데이터 검색 및 쿼리 데이터베이스 소프트웨어는 사용자가 원하는 데이터를 쉽게 검색할 수 있도록 다양한 쿼리 언어를 지원합니다.
가장 일반적으로 사용되는 쿼리 언어는 SQL(Structured Query Language)입니다.
SQL을 사용하면 사용자는 복잡한 조건에 따라 데이터를 필터링하고, 정렬하며, 집계할 수 있습니다.
이러한 기능은 데이터 분석 및 보고서 작성에 매우 유용합니다.
4. 동시성 제어 여러 사용자가 동시에 데이터베이스에 접근할 수 있는 환경에서 데이터의 일관성을 유지하는 것은 매우 중요합니다.
데이터베이스 소프트웨어는 동시성 제어 메커니즘을 통해 여러 사용자가 동시에 데이터를 수정할 때 발생할 수 있는 충돌을 방지합니다.
이를 통해 데이터의 일관성을 유지하고, 사용자 경험을 향상시킬 수 있습니다.
5. 보안 관리 데이터베이스 소프트웨어는 데이터의 보안을 강화하기 위한 다양한 기능을 제공합니다.
사용자 인증 및 권한 관리 기능을 통해 특정 사용자만 데이터에 접근하거나 수정할 수 있도록 제한할 수 있습니다.
또한, 데이터 암호화 기능을 통해 민감한 정보를 보호하고, 데이터 유출을 방지할 수 있습니다.
6. 백업 및 복구 데이터베이스 소프트웨어는 데이터 손실을 방지하기 위해 정기적인 백업 기능을 제공합니다.
데이터베이스가 손상되거나 시스템 장애가 발생했을 때, 백업된 데이터를 통해 신속하게 복구할 수 있습니다.
이는 비즈니스 연속성을 유지하는 데 중요한 역할을 합니다.
7. 데이터 분석 및 보고 현대의 데이터베이스 소프트웨어는 데이터 분석 및 비즈니스 인텔리전스(BI) 도구와 통합되어, 사용자가 데이터를 기반으로 인사이트를 도출할 수 있도록 지원합니다.
이를 통해 기업은 데이터 기반의 의사 결정을 내릴 수 있으며, 시장 변화에 빠르게 대응할 수 있습니다.
8. 데이터 통합 데이터베이스 소프트웨어는 다양한 출처에서 데이터를 통합하여 중앙 집중식으로 관리할 수 있는 기능을 제공합니다.
이는 기업이 여러 시스템에서 발생하는 데이터를 통합하여 보다 포괄적인 분석을 수행할 수 있도록 돕습니다.
결론 데이터베이스 소프트웨어는 단순한 데이터 저장소 이상의 역할을 수행합니다.
데이터의 효율적인 관리, 무결성 유지, 보안 강화, 분석 지원 등 다양한 기능을 통해 기업의 정보 시스템을 지원하고, 데이터 기반의 의사 결정을 가능하게 합니다.
따라서 데이터베이스 소프트웨어는 현대 비즈니스 환경에서 필수적인 도구로 자리 잡고 있습니다.
작성자:
이은채 [비회원]
| 작성일자: 1년 전
2024-11-01 10:51:19
조회수: 179 | 댓글: 0 | 좋아요: 0 | 싫어요: 0
조회수: 179 | 댓글: 0 | 좋아요: 0 | 싫어요: 0
내용이 부정확하다면 싫어요를 클릭해주세요.